Taxonomic Classification

Rank Barred Tiger Salamander Fly
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Arthropoda (Arthropods)
Class Amphibia (Amphibians) Insecta (Insects)
Order Caudata (Caudata) Diptera (Diptera)
Family Ambystomatidae Agromyzidae
Genus Ambystoma Phytomyza
Species Ambystoma mavortium Phytomyza hellebori
